Output 728049ee1876d568ca8da388c4775231fce71cb540930338fe503714e8a91c94:0

value
76000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ea89367abc7a1a6d5ade1de202819a52a83897 OP_EQUAL
address
33xm6zbLkfk7HHJEbe5zE6btouGSw6e3bD
transaction
728049ee1876d568ca8da388c4775231fce71cb540930338fe503714e8a91c94
confirmations
275949
spent
true